A member asked:

Pain started in ear now hurts in ear, jaw, teeth, neck, cheek, head on one side. hurts same side when swallow. trigeminal neuralgia? possibilities?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Trigeminal anatomy: True trigeminal neuralgia is a sudden intense pain over a portion of the face lasting a few seconds at most, and likely immobilizing the victim. Your description suggests a different process, perhaps a TMJ, or dental issue such as an abscessed tooth. Start with your dentist first, and see if you can find answers.
